Inclusion criteria
Inclusion criteria: -males and females - patients of 18 years and older - secondary Dupuytren's contracture - PIP > 30 degrees / MCP > 20 degrees - one or more affected rays - severe or less severe diatheses - ASA criteria I, II, and III
Exclusion criteria
Exclusion criteria: - Primary Dupuytren*s contracture - Amputation of 1 or more fingers of the affected hand. - More than 2 times hand surgery in the affected ray. - disorder (trauma/congenital) in the past that affects the affected finger (0-situation is unknown). - Dystrophic characteristics in the past. - use of anticoagulants that can not be stopped for surgery - ASA IV and V
Design outcomes
Primary
| Measure | Time frame |
|---|---|
| - Convalescence: return to function and return to work - VAS score: standardized list of questions about pain and well-being of the patient; to register the pain of the hand and donor site. - Contracture reductions: 1) Total passive extension deficity (TPED): the sum of the passive extension deficits of the metacarpophalangeal, proximal interphalangeal, and distal interphalangeal joints. 2) Boyes measure: measuring the distance from pulp to distal palmar crease with the hand in a maximum fist position. Flexion is defined as reduced if the distance is more than 1.5 cm. | — |
